Prime Video's hit series Reacher has cast Christopher Rodriguez-Marquette as Jacob Merrick, a small-town policeman, in its upcoming fourth season. The news was reported by Deadline, and PEOPLE has reached out to reps at Prime Video for comment.
Rodriguez-Marquette, known for his roles in RZR and Barry, steps into the role after Jay Baruchel initially cast but had to back out due to a personal matter.
The fourth season of Reacher is set to adapt Lee Child's 2009 novel Gone Tomorrow, which follows the story of Jack Reacher, played by Alan Ritchson. Ritchson confirmed the news on Instagram earlier this month, quoting a line from the book: "The thing about subway cars is you step on one and you never know what's going to happen."

Rodriguez-Marquette's acting credits date back to the mid-90s, with roles in Aliens in the Family, The Mummy series, Joan of Arcadia, and Strong Medicine. He has also made appearances in shows like Beverly Hills, 90210, Law & Order, and Lucifer.
Reacher was renewed for a fourth season before the third season even premiered. Production is currently underway, with an official premiere date yet to be announced.
In other news, former U.S. President Joe Biden accidentally crashed the Reacher set as the show was filming in Philadelphia earlier this month. Alan Ritchson shared a photo with Biden on Instagram, saying: "Was a privilege and honor to meet the Biden family. They couldn't have been more lovely. Kind, joyful, gracious and present."
